SN74HC166NS Description

SN74HC166NS Description

The SN74HC166NS is a high-performance, 8-bit shift register designed for parallel or serial to serial data conversion. Manufactured by Texas Instruments, this device is part of the 74HC series, known for its robustness and reliability in logic IC chips. The SN74HC166NS features a single element with 8 bits per element, making it ideal for applications requiring efficient data handling and processing.

SN74HC166NS Features

  • Logic Type: The SN74HC166NS is a shift register, capable of converting parallel data to serial format and vice versa. This dual functionality enhances its versatility in various digital circuits.
  • Supply Voltage: Operating within a range of 2V to 6V, this IC is designed to be compatible with a wide range of power supplies, ensuring flexibility in system design.
  • Mounting Type: The surface mount package of the SN74HC166NS allows for easy integration into modern PCB designs, optimizing space and improving thermal performance.
  • Compliance: The device is REACH unaffected and ROHS3 compliant, ensuring it meets the latest environmental and safety standards. This compliance is crucial for manufacturers aiming to adhere to global regulations.
  • Moisture Sensitivity Level (MSL): With an MSL rating of 1 (Unlimited), the SN74HC166NS is highly resistant to moisture, making it suitable for storage and use in various environmental conditions.
  • Packaging: Available in a tube package, the SN74HC166NS is protected during shipping and handling, reducing the risk of damage and ensuring the integrity of the device.
